Intra-articular hyaluronate, tenoxicam and vitamin E in a rat model of osteoarthritis: evaluation and comparison of chondroprotective efficacy.

AbstractOBJECTIVE:
The aim of this experimental study was to evaluate and compare the chondroprotective efficacy of intra-articular hyaluronic acid, tenoxicam and vitamin E in osteoarthritis.
METHODS:
An osteoarthritis model was created by anterior cruciate ligament transection and medial menisectomy in knees of 28 rats. The rats were randomized into four groups; first group served as a control group and received intra-articular injections of saline solution, intra-articular HA, intra-articular tenoxicam and intra-articular Vit E were applied to the treatment groups. First intra-articular injections were applied at second week postoperatively and repeated once a week for 5 weeks. At 8th week after the operation groups were compared based on the histologic scores of cartilage degeneration by Mankin Histological Grading Scale.
RESULTS:
Total cartilage degeneration score was significantly increased in the control group (P=0.004). Total Mankin scores of HA, tenoxicam and Vit E groups were significantly lower than the control group (P=0.004, P=0.016, P=0.012 respectively). There was no statistically siginificant difference between the treatment groups in terms of total Mankin scores (P>0.05).
CONCLUSION:
Intra-articular application of HA, tenoxicam and Vit E are chondroprotective in early osteoarthritis model in rats. Chondroprotective activity of tenoxicam and Vit E are comparable with the beneficial effects of HA on articular cartilage.
